Finished Steel Products Market, Segmentation by Form
The Finished Steel Products Market is segmented by Form, with key categories including plate, strip, rod & bar, profile, tube, wire, and others. Each form serves different applications across various industries, contributing to the market's growth based on end-user needs and production requirements.
Plate
Plate steel products are widely used in construction, shipbuilding, and machinery manufacturing due to their strength and durability. These products are essential for heavy-duty applications where structural integrity and weight-bearing capabilities are critical.
Strip
Strip steel products are thin, flat pieces of steel used in various industrial applications, including automotive manufacturing, construction, and appliance production. Their versatility and ease of processing make them ideal for high-volume production processes.
Rod & Bar
Rod & bar products are commonly used in the construction and infrastructure industries for reinforcing concrete and manufacturing machinery. Their strong, malleable properties make them suitable for a wide range of applications, from structural support to machinery parts.
Profile
Profile steel products are specialized shapes, such as beams, channels, and angles, used extensively in the construction and infrastructure sectors. They provide structural support and are often used in the fabrication of steel frameworks, buildings, and bridges.
Tube
Tube steel products are used in a variety of applications, including automotive, construction, and energy. Their hollow structure makes them ideal for fluid and gas transportation, as well as structural applications requiring strength and flexibility.
Wire
Wire steel products are used in applications that require flexibility and strength, such as fencing, cables, and reinforcement in construction. Their versatility and adaptability make them crucial in the electrical, automotive, and construction industries.
Others
The others category includes specialized steel products like steel sheets, coils, and custom shapes that cater to niche industries such as aerospace, electronics, and defense. These products are tailored to meet specific requirements, ensuring high-performance and reliability.
Finished Steel Products Market, Segmentation by Process
The Finished Steel Products Market is segmented by Process, with categories including hot-rolling, cold-rolling, forging, casting, extrusion & drawing, and additive manufacturing of steel. Each process is suited to specific product requirements, influencing the final steel product's properties, strength, and versatility.
Hot-Rolling
Hot-rolling is a process used to produce large quantities of steel products, particularly for structural components. This process involves heating steel above its recrystallization temperature, making it easier to shape and form. Hot-rolled products are often used in construction, automotive, and heavy machinery manufacturing due to their strength and cost-effectiveness.
Cold-Rolling
Cold-rolling is used to produce steel products with a smooth, finished surface and higher dimensional accuracy. This process is typically used for products such as strips and sheets in applications requiring a high-quality surface finish and precise tolerances, such as automotive and appliance manufacturing.
Forging
Forging involves shaping steel products through compressive force, producing components with enhanced strength and durability. Forged steel products are used in critical applications, such as aerospace, automotive, and defense, where high performance and resistance to stress are required.
Casting
Casting is a process used to create steel products by pouring molten metal into a mold. This method is ideal for producing complex shapes and is commonly used in the production of components for heavy machinery, automotive, and industrial equipment.
Extrusion & Drawing
Extrusion & drawing are processes used to create long shapes of steel, such as rods, tubes, and profiles. These methods are commonly used in industries like construction, transportation, and industrial equipment manufacturing, where specific shapes are needed for structural or functional purposes.
Additive Manufacturing of Steel
Additive manufacturing, also known as 3D printing, is an emerging technology in the steel industry that allows for the creation of complex parts with less material waste. This process is particularly useful for producing customized, lightweight components in industries like aerospace and automotive.
Finished Steel Products Market, Segmentation by End-User Industry
The Finished Steel Products Market is segmented by End-User Industry, with key sectors including construction & infrastructure, transportation, energy, containers & packaging, electrical & electronics, machinery & equipment, and defense & security. Each sector relies on steel products for different applications, ranging from structural components to high-performance parts.
Construction & Infrastructure
The construction & infrastructure industry is the largest consumer of finished steel products, with steel used in the construction of buildings, bridges, roads, and other infrastructure. Steel products like profiles, plates, and rods are essential for creating the framework and structural support needed for large-scale projects.
Transportation
The transportation industry uses a wide range of finished steel products in the manufacturing of vehicles, including cars, trucks, and trains. Steel is used for its strength, durability, and formability, making it an essential material for creating the body, chassis, and components of vehicles.
Energy
The energy industry relies on steel for applications such as power plants, oil rigs, pipelines, and renewable energy infrastructure. Steel is used for its strength and resistance to high temperatures, making it suitable for equipment and structures that operate under harsh conditions.
Containers & Packaging
The containers & packaging sector utilizes steel products, particularly for the production of durable containers for storing and transporting goods. Steel is used in packaging for its strength, protection against contamination, and recyclability, which is essential in industries like food and beverage, chemicals, and pharmaceuticals.
Electrical & Electronics
The electrical & electronics industry uses steel in the manufacturing of components such as transformers, motors, and electrical enclosures. Steel's strength and conductivity make it ideal for creating durable, long-lasting electronic equipment.
Machinery & Equipment
The machinery & equipment sector utilizes steel in the production of industrial machines, construction equipment, and tools. Steel's versatility and strength make it ideal for manufacturing durable and high-performance machinery used across various industries.
Defense & Security
The defense & security industry uses finished steel products for manufacturing military equipment, including vehicles, weapons, and protective gear. Steel's durability and high resistance to stress and impact are essential for ensuring the safety and effectiveness of defense products.

Restraints
- Fluctuating raw material prices
- Environmental and regulatory challenges
-
High energy consumption in steel production: Steel production is an energy-intensive process, requiring significant amounts of electricity and fuel to convert raw materials into finished steel products. The high energy consumption associated with steel manufacturing poses challenges for producers, particularly in terms of operating costs and environmental impact. Energy expenses can account for a substantial portion of the overall production cost, making efficiency improvements and energy management crucial for maintaining competitiveness in the market.
The environmental implications of high energy consumption in steel production are also a major concern. The industry is a significant source of greenhouse gas emissions, contributing to climate change and air pollution. As global awareness of environmental issues increases, steel producers face growing pressure to reduce their carbon footprint and adopt more sustainable practices. This has led to a push for innovations in energy efficiency and the development of greener production technologies to mitigate the environmental impact.
To address these challenges, the steel industry is investing in advanced technologies and processes that enhance energy efficiency and reduce emissions. Efforts include the adoption of electric arc furnaces, which are more energy-efficient than traditional blast furnaces, and the use of renewable energy sources to power production facilities. Additionally, research into alternative materials and recycling processes aims to lower the energy demand of steel production. These initiatives not only help reduce operating costs but also align with the global shift towards sustainability, presenting opportunities for growth and leadership in the market.
Opportunities
- Development of high-strength and lightweight steel alloys
- Expansion into new markets with infrastructure projects
-
Increasing focus on sustainable and eco-friendly production methods: The increasing focus on sustainable and eco-friendly production methods is becoming a pivotal trend in the global finished steel products market. As environmental concerns intensify, there is growing pressure on steel manufacturers to adopt greener practices. This shift is driven by stringent environmental regulations, the need to reduce carbon footprints, and the rising awareness among consumers and industries about the importance of sustainability. Companies are investing in innovative technologies and processes to minimize their environmental impact, such as using renewable energy sources, recycling scrap metal, and implementing energy-efficient production techniques.
Technological advancements are playing a critical role in enabling sustainable steel production. Innovations such as electric arc furnaces, which utilize scrap steel and reduce reliance on raw materials, are becoming more widespread. Additionally, advancements in carbon capture and storage (CCS) technologies are helping steel manufacturers reduce greenhouse gas emissions. These technologies not only enhance the environmental performance of steel production but also improve operational efficiency, leading to cost savings and competitive advantages for manufacturers who adopt them.
The push towards sustainability is also opening up new market opportunities for finished steel products. As industries worldwide strive to meet their sustainability goals, there is increasing demand for eco-friendly steel products in various applications, including construction, automotive, and renewable energy sectors. Steel products that are manufactured using green processes and materials are gaining preference, driving innovation and growth in the market. This trend is expected to continue, with sustainable and eco-friendly production methods becoming a key differentiator for companies in the global finished steel products market.
